What is the difference between 'Direct plan' and 'Retail plan' in a MF scheme?

Its not Direct and Retail, its Direct and Regular plan.

A Direct plan is where you interact with the AMC of the fund directly and invest/buy MF units. In a Regular plan,you do it through an agent who helps you in buying these MF units for which he charges a commission.

The Direct Plan has a lower expense ratio as compared to existing plans in the same schemes since there is no commission to be paid to the distributor under this plan.It is obviously better to invest in direct plans for higher returns, but this also requires more hard work from the investor as he has to do the paperwork and choose a suitable fund.
